    Engineer equipment arrives for Saber Strike 15

    DRAWSKO POMORSKIE, POLAND

    06.10.2015

    Photo by Sgt. Brandon Anderson 

    13th Public Affairs Detachment

    A Soldier assigned to 2nd Platoon, 500th Engineer Company, 15th Engineer Battalion, ground guides a D-7 military dozer while offloading it from a rail car June 10, 2015, near the Drawsko Pomorskie Training Area. These dozers will be used to dig vehicle fighting positions, anti-tank ditches and other earth-moving requirements during Saber Strike, a long-standing U.S. Army Europe-led cooperative training exercise. This year’s exercise objectives facilitate cooperation among the U.S., Estonia, Latvia, Lithuania, and Poland to improve joint operational capability in a range of missions as well as preparing the participating nations and units to support multinational contingency operations. There are more than 6,000 participants from 13 different nations. (U.S. Army photo by Sgt. Brandon Anderson, 13th Public Affairs Detachment/Released)
